TUATARA -- guests -- live performance and chat
Tuatara is an instrumental group whose 7 members each play many instruments
including vibes, marimbas, saxophones, woodwinds, flutes, keyboards and all
manner of drums, percussion and guitars. The band is Peter Buck (R.E.M.),
Barrett Martin (Screaming Trees), Justin Harwood (Luna), Skerik, Mike Stone,
Craig Florey and Scott McCaughey (The Minus 5).

I spoke by phone with historian Doug Brinkley (author of "The Majic Bus,"
editor of the recently published letters of Hunter Thompson, and biographer of
Jimmy Carter) who was a friend of the televison journalist Charles Kuralt who
died in New York City on July 4 at the age of 62. Doug spoke about the
little-known friendship between Kuralt and Hunter Thompson and philosophized
about the historical significance of Kuralt's famous "On The Road" essays.
Doug, who heads up the Eisenhower Center for American Studies at the
University of New Orleans, spoke from a small house-on-stilts on the Gulf of
Mexico in Bay St. Louis, Mississippi, where he is currently writing a massive
"history of America" to be published next year by Viking Penguin. When he
lived in New York (where he taught at Hofstra University) he was often a guest
on my show.

The Stephens, Hurt and Justice tracks are from Harry Smith's famous "Anthology
Of American Folk Music," which Smithsonian Folkways is getting ready to
reissue as a 6-CD set on the occasion of it's forty-fifth anniversary. This
collection back in the fifties and sixties influenced an entire generation of
musicians and was a major source of inspiration for Bob Dylan, Joan Baez,
Jerry Garcia, The Band and countless others. This is the collection that
Greil Marcus writes about extensively in his recently published book about the
Dylan/Band "basement tapes." For further information contact Smithsonian
